This internship is expected to start around April 14th, 2025 and end by December 31st, 2025. The internship will provide the opportunity to learn of Mercedes-Benz Electrified Vehicles from the different aspects of the product development cycle and stakeholder’s roles and responsibilities. 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Experience in planning, testing, and evaluation on high-voltage wide bandgap based power devices (silicon carbide, gallium nitride, etc.) such as double-pulse testing, static characterization, and results analysis. 
  • Develop functional simulation models of power electronic components including inverter, motor, gate drivers, DCDC converters, etc. Develop a comprehensive EV powertrain simulation model characterize semiconductor impact on performance.
  • Carry out competitor analysis (benchmark) of power electronics solutions and to develop an interactive and visual database capturing key performance metrics.
  • Regular and proactive communication with stakeholders to update status, delays, risks, and challenges.
